This article lists the world's busiest container ports, by total number of twenty-foot equivalent units (TEUs) transported through the port. The table lists volume in thousands of TEU per year. The vast majority of containers moved by large, ocean-faring container ships are 20-foot and 40-foot ISO-standard shipping containers, with 40-foot units mostly dominating high volume ports listed here. Therefore, the numbers given below should not be interpreted as the amount of containers handled.
